Marco Penge announced a pause from professional golf after missing the cut at the PGA Championship at Aronimink, citing ongoing health issues and a need to focus on getting his health back to where it needs to be. He indicated he would take time away but suggested a return in the future. This was reported by Golf Magic and echoed by several outlets in mid-May 2026.[1][2]
Reports specify that Penge has been dealing with vertigo-like symptoms and a complicated health picture involving his ear, neck, and nervous system, traced to a viral infection from the previous year. He also disclosed additional health checks (including MRI) with preliminary reassuring results.[3][1]
The announcement followed a run of recent struggles, including withdrawal from the Myrtle Beach Classic prior to the PGA Championship and a missed cut at Aronimink, highlighting the timing of the decision to step away.[2][3]
Media coverage in early to mid-May 2026 consistently frames this as a temporary break to prioritize health, with indications that he intends to return to competitive golf when able. Some outlets emphasize the positive signs in his 2025 season on the DP World Tour and his pathway to rising through the ranks.[4][1][3]

www.yardbarker.comTurned pro in 2017 after a successful amateur career which included a victory at the Scottish Strokeplay in 2015. Earned his first professional title at the 2019 Prem Group Irish Masters on the EuroPro Tour. Ended that season third on the EuroPro Tour Order of Merit to secure a place on the HotelPlanner Tour the following year.
